While Yate Train Station is not the most lavish of stops, it does cater to the essential needs of passengers. The ticket office is open from 07:00 to 11:00 on weekdays, providing a window for purchasing your journey's pass ahead. Worry not if you need to collect online tickets—automated machines are conveniently available, all equipped with accessible features to ensure everyone can use them easily.
Unfortunately, there are no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so make sure to prepare your necessities beforehand. For those with accessibility needs, Yate offers partial step-free access. However, be prepared for a bit of maneuvering if you're heading to the northbound platform, as it involves navigating a bridge and a steep ramp. Assistance and information are available and can be accessed through help points scattered around the station.
Yate isn't just a place to pause; it acts as a gateway to further journeys, easily connecting to other transportation. Rail replacement services and local buses add a layer of convenience, with buses operating from the station's car park and main road stops. At Hackney Downs, convenience is a key feature. The station is equipped with automated ticket machines, making ticket purchases and collections a breeze. Although the ticket office operates only in the mornings from Monday to Friday, passengers can still collect pre-purchased tickets from the machines available on site. The station ensures accessibility by providing acc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for the hearing impaired, ensuring every traveler receives necessary assistance.
The station provides a range of customer support services with information and help available via dedicated help points. Staff are consistently on hand to assist passengers, particularly during weekdays and Saturdays from 06:20 to 20:00, and on Sundays with limited hours. For passengers with mobility concerns, the station offers step-free access to the southbound Platform 1 via Hackney Walkway, although users should verify lift availability.
Travelers can enjoy small comforts such as vending machines for cold drinks and snacks along with a few shops present on Platform 1. Although there are no ATM or cash services provided at the station, you can find various conveniences close by in the adjoining areas of Hackney.
Hackney Downs station serves as a connecting hub with various transport links. For those affected by rail service disruptions, replacement bus services are readily available, departing from Amhurst Road to several destinations including Enfield Town and Liverpool Street. Regular London buses also operate from outside the station, making seamless connections to the city’s extensive public transportation network.
